The Elisp info material states in "39.12 Faces": 

      Many parts of Emacs require named faces, and do not accept
   anonymous faces. These include the functions documented in Attribute
   Functions, and the variable ‘font-lock-keywords’ (see Search-based
   Fontification). Unless otherwise stated, we will use the term “face”
   to refer only to named faces.

However, when I start Emacs with "emacs -Q", and then evaluate in
the *scratch* buffer the form:

    (progn
      (font-lock-add-keywords nil '(("hello" 0 '(:background "green")) t))
      (insert "hello"))

then I see that "hello" is inserted and highlighted in green, apparently
due to search-based fontification where an anonymous face is specified!

I am currently working on an application where this functionality (i.e.,
anonymous faces that can be specified for fontification) would be
extremely useful. Could you please consider supporting this feature,
and - if this already works as intended - officially document it?
